NEW DELHI – A 25-year-old Muslim youth, Ali Khan, was beaten to death, allegedly by a Hindutva mob, following a dispute over a seat on a train while he was traveling in Betul district, Madhya Pradesh, on Sunday. According to reports, Khan, a resident of Chhindwara district, was traveling with his friends – Jayant Vishwakarma, Shivam Malviya, and Yash – on vacation when the incident occurred. Ali Khan, a 24-year-old resident of Chhindwara, was allegedly beaten to death after being dragged out of a train at Madhya Pradesh’s Bordehi railway station. Family and friends allege the attack followed a dispute over a train seat with a man claiming links to a right-wing group. Police say an FIR is being registered and CCTV footage is being examined.
